    Abstract: Systems and methods for point to multipoint communications are provided. In one example, a system includes one or more modal antennas. Each modal antenna is configured to operate in a plurality of modes. The system can include a transceiver configured to communicate with a plurality of client devices over a wireless communication medium via the one or more modal antennas over a plurality of frames. The system can include one or more control devices configured to control the operation of the one or more modal antennas. For each of the plurality of frames communicated to one of the plurality of client devices, the one or more control devices are configured to determine a selected mode of the plurality of modes to communicate during the frame and to operate at least one of the one or more modal antennas in the selected mode during the frame.

    Abstract: A method for configuring a multi-mode antenna system is provided. The method includes obtaining channel selection data indicating the antenna system is tuned to a first channel of a plurality of channels. The method includes configuring the antenna system in at least one operating mode of a plurality of operating modes, with each operating mode of the plurality of operating modes having a distinct radiation pattern. The method includes obtaining data indicative of a channel quality indicator for the at least one operating mode. The method includes determining a selected operating mode for the multi-mode antenna system for the first channel of the plurality of channels based, at least in part, on the data indicative of the channel quality indicator. The method includes configuring the antenna system in the selected operating mode when the multi-mode antenna system is tuned to the first channel.

    Abstract: An antenna system for use with one or more media devices is provided. The antenna system includes a plurality of antenna elements. Each antenna element is associated with an independent feed element. In addition each antenna element is configured to receive a plurality of radio frequency (RF) signals. Each RF signal can be associated with a UHF band or a VHF band. The antenna system can include at least one tuner and at least one switching device. The at least one switching device can be configured to selectively couple the at least one tuner to one antenna element of the plurality of antenna elements based, at least in part, on channel selection data associated with the at least one tuner.

    Abstract: An RFIC with memory is described where the memory can be used to house a look-up table for tuning components designed into the RFIC, providing a customized tuning circuit for antenna and transceiver front-end tuning applications. The look-up table can be loaded at wafer level during the manufacturing process to customize an RFIC design for a specific antenna system. The memory can be used to restrict or tailor the tuning range of tunable capacitors and switches within the RFIC to optimize performance in the end application. The resident memory will improve signaling latency when tuning for time critical applications such as channel tuning in a cellular communication system.

    Abstract: An antenna system is integrated into a cover or accessory and adapted to couple to an antenna in a host device to improve transmission and reception of signals. The antenna system can be passive or active, with the active antenna system designed to amplify coupled signals on the integrated antenna elements in the cover or accessory. Single or multiple frequency bands can be improved with the integrated antenna system, and multiple antennas in the host device can be coupled to and improved. The antenna system can couple to the existing antennas in the host device by capacitive coupling, i.e. no physical contact required, or a connector can be designed into the cover or accessory containing the integrated antenna system that makes contact to electrical ground of the host device or power supply signals or other control signals.
